Output ea76ac55e422fca10126190b1fd2ebf13e854780f94543ded944284daa51b4d6:1

value
833518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b212fc9eb998227684bf46b6f75108012626a22 OP_EQUAL
address
34ATvaEQ8QVUoLVZ87J5b8emNB5bCeX1bF
transaction
ea76ac55e422fca10126190b1fd2ebf13e854780f94543ded944284daa51b4d6
confirmations
307901
spent
true